- Character Notes -
Even before the Mage War broke out Nicholas created problems for himself. Living in Miragon the only life that he was able to create for himself was the life of a Thief. Even though Nicholas hated it his skills far surpassed everyone else's. He created a name for himself by stealing some very precious magical items and jewels. Nicholas continued on his path unaware of anything else that he could choise until he crossed paths with Juliet. The one thing that Nicholas couldn't do was to hurt a woman and when he saw that a strange woman, who he would later get to know as Juliet, being robbed by some bandits Nicholas jumped in the was to take a knife in place of Juliet. Even knowing Nicholas's true nature Juliet fell in love with the man himself. Fullfilling Juliet's wishes to be taken to the man with whom she was arranged to be married to with which Nicholas agreed to do. Upon meeting the Duke of the Augustine Empire in the common year (cy) 995 Nicholas knew that Juliet was far to good for the likes of that man and with the time that they spent together Juliet ended up falling in love with Nicholas agreeing that she didn't want to marry the Duke. Being an arranged marriage, the Duke didn't care for the ways of love and upon hearing of Nicholas's wishes to marry Juliet the Duke had Nicholas cursed with lycanthorpy so that he would never be able to touch to one he loved. Being cursed in the body of a Were-Wolf each night Nicholas researched the only way to release himself from that curse, which was to kill the person whom cursed him in the first place. With the help of a group of travelers under the tutalidge of a strange man by the name of Dre - Nicholas was able to face the Duke as a human. He demanded that the Duke lift the curse so that he and his loved one Juliet would be able to live in peace together. The Duke had other plans and killed Juliet before he would give her up. The Duke was killed by his mistress, Queen Diana, but Nicholas only cared about burying the one he loved under the tree that they made their bond of friendship. As Nicholas gave a prayer over her grave the sun set on final time however, Nicholas stayed as a human just like he has since. With Juliet dead and buried Nicholas joined along with the adventurers when they said that they could fullfill his greatest wish.
